> FIJI, 3D2. Franz, DK1II will be QRV as 3D2II from Lautoka, Vita
> Levu, IOTA OC-016, from August 24 to September 2. He is working
> here on a community project, so his operating time will be limited.
> Activity will be on 40 to 10 meters, using mostly CW. QSL via
> ZL2III.
>
> MALAWI, 7Q. Harry, G0JMU is QRV as 7Q7HB and is here for a couple
> of months. QSL direct via G0IAS.
>
> GHANA, 9G. Henk, PA3AWW will be QRV as 9G1AA from August 30 to
> September 12 while working at the Dormaa hospital. QSL to home
> call.
>
> QATAR, A7. Juma, A71EM is QRV from Doha and has been active using
> RTTY on 20 meters around 1900z. QSL via LZ1YE.
>
> CEUTA AND MELILLA, EA9. Henri, EA9GW is usually QRV daily on 20
> meters using SSB between 2300 and 0200z.
>
> MOLDOVA, ER. Special station ER27A is active until August 27 to
> celebrate the Independence Day of Moldova. QSL via ER1DA.
>
> ST. MARTIN, FS. Gregg, W6IZT will be QRV as FS/W6IZT from August 23
> to September 1. He is active on all bands using CW and SSB. QSL to
> home call.
>
> SCOTLAND, GM. Four operators from the Scottish-Russian ARS will be
> QRV as GB0SKY from the Isle of Skye, IOTA EU-008, August 24 and 25.
> Activity will be on 160 to 10 meters using CW and SSB. They may
> also try to be QRV from the summit Squrr na Coinnich as MM0DFV/p
> using QRP power near 14030 kHz. QSL both calls via MM0DFV.
>
> JORDAN, JY. George, JY9QJ has been QRV on 160 meters around 0230z.
> QSL via DL5MBY.
>
> SUDAN, ST. ST2BSS has been QRV on 20 meters SSB around 1600z. QSL
> via DL5NAM.
>
> DODECANESE, SV5. Hubert, DK9NCX is QRV as SV5/DK9NCX until
> September 3. He is active using SSB and QRP CW. QSL to home call.
>
> PALAU, T8. Haruki, JH9URT is QRV as T88HO until August 26. This is
> his first DXpedition. He is active on all HF bands, including 6
> meters, using SSB. QSL to home call.
>
> MICRONESIA, V6. Roger, G3SXW and Nigel, G3TXF plan to be QRV as
> V63SXW and V63TXF, respectively, from Yap Island, IOTA OC-012, from
> August 27 to September 3. They will take a side-trip to the
> relatively rare Falalop Island in the Ulithi Atoll, IOTA OC- 078,
> from August 29 to September 1. From here they will be QRV as
> V63SXW/p and V63TXF/p, respectively. This is a CW only operation
> with low power. QSL V63SXW and V63SXW/p via G3SXW. QSL V63TXF and
> V63TXF/p via G3TXF.
>
> IRAQ, YI. Robert, YI/S53R has been QRV on 30 meters around 0200z.
> QSL via K2PF.
>
> UK SOVEREIGN BASE AREAS ON CYPRUS, ZC4. Geoff, ZC4CW will be active
> from the Eastern Base for the next few years. QSL via G3AB.

> DXCC Operations Approved. The following station, along with its
> effective date, is approved for DXCC credit: E4/DF3EC, August 7 to
> 10, 2003.
>
> THIS WEEKEND ON THE RADIO. The Ohio and Hawaii QSO Parties, NRRL
> 75th Anniversary Contest, TOEC WW Grid Contest, SCC RTTY
> Championship and the CQC Summer QSO Party will certainly keep
> contesters busy this weekend. Please see August QST, pages 91 and
> 92, and the ARRL and WA7BNM contest websites for details.
